About the Author

The author of ‘Look Me In The Eye’, John Elder Robison, is an American writer, musician and advocate for people with autism. He was diagnosed with Asperger’s syndrome at the age of 40 and has since then become a leading voice in the autism community. His first book, ‘Look Me In The Eye’ is a New York Times bestseller and has been translated into over 15 languages.

Book Summary

‘Look Me In The Eye’ is a memoir that chronicles John Elder Robison’s life growing up with undiagnosed Asperger’s syndrome in the 1960s and 1970s. It offers a unique perspective on what it’s like to live with autism and how it can affect one’s relationships, career and overall life experiences. Through his honest and often humorous storytelling, Robison takes readers on a journey through his childhood, teenage years and adulthood, sharing his struggles and triumphs along the way.
